Learn soil mechanics, foundations and geotechnicsVolumetric and gravimetric relations of soils. Granulometry and Plasticity. Classification according to AASHTO and SUCS.
Soil compaction. Water flow in soils, one-dimensional and two-dimensional. Stresses in a soil mass and stress increment. Theory of consolidation and settlements. Soil shear strength. Principal stresses and Mohr's circle in soils. Mohr-Coulomb fault theory. Resistance tests (direct shear, triaxial, etc.). Lateral pressure in soils, Rankine and Coulomb theory thrusts. Design of retaining walls. Slope stability. GEOSLOPE. Shallow foundations theory and design. Deep foundations theory and design. Field trials: SPT, CPT, etc.
